Another method, which I have used, is to find a hardened bolt with a head of the correct size (22mm or 7/8in, for the current application). Screw down and tighten real hard three nuts on the bolt. Then put the head of the bolt into the allen cavity and turn it counter clockwise with an open-end wrench on the nut nearest the bolt head. Use a hardened bolt dso as not to break off the bolt head in the allen cavity with attendant problems getting it out.
